Unpacking the Surge: Factors Driving Rental Price Increases in Ljubljana's Tech District

The surge in rental prices within Ljubljana's tech district can be attributed to a confluence of factors that reflect both local and global trends. First and foremost, the rapid expansion of the tech industry in the region has attracted a wave of skilled professionals seeking proximity to their workplaces. This influx has heightened demand for housing, outpacing the available supply. Additionally, the district's appeal is amplified by its vibrant community atmosphere, modern amenities, and proximity to educational institutions, making it a desirable location for young professionals and families alike.

Moreover, the broader economic recovery post-pandemic has led to increased disposable incomes, allowing more individuals to invest in quality housing. Investors, recognizing the potential for lucrative returns, have also contributed to the rising prices by purchasing properties to rent out. Finally, the limited availability of land for new developments further exacerbates the situation, creating a competitive market where prospective tenants are willing to pay a premium for desirable living spaces.

Tech Boom and Housing Crunch: The Impact on Prospective Renters and Local Economy

The rapid expansion of the tech sector in Ljubljana has created a dual-edged sword for prospective renters and the local economy. As startups and established tech firms flock to the city, the demand for housing has surged, leading to a significant rise in rental prices. This influx of high-income professionals has driven up competition for available units, pushing many long-time residents out of the market. The housing crunch not only affects affordability but also alters the demographic makeup of the community, as younger, tech-savvy individuals dominate the rental landscape.

Simultaneously, the local economy witnesses a boost from increased spending power among tech employees, fostering growth in retail, dining, and service industries. However, this economic uplift comes at a cost, as the rising cost of living threatens to marginalize lower-income households. The challenge lies in balancing the benefits of a booming tech hub with the need for inclusive housing solutions that ensure all residents can thrive in Ljubljana's evolving landscape.
